House Passes Bills
On Alternative Energy
And Cybersecurity
WASHINGTON-The U.S. House of
Representatives in late September passed
a bill to boost alternative energy that
some oil and gas advocates deem the
wrong approach at the wrong time. The
month also saw the House approve
legislation intended to prevent successful
cyberattacks against the country's power
grid and other energy infrastructure.
The House passed HR 4447, the
Clean Energy Jobs and Innovation Act,
on Sept. 24. According to its sponsor,
Representative Tom O'Halleran, D-Az.,
the legislation aims to invest in electric
grid modernization and security,
increase the availability and
affordability of renewable energy and
storage technology, and make targeted
workforce investments as the country
transitions toward renewable energy by:
· Creating and funding a career
skills program through the U.S.
Department of Energy to train workers
for constructing and installing energyefficient building technologies;
· Streamlining available federal
energy efficiency programs and
financing to help improve efficiency and
lower energy costs for schools;
· Directing the secretary of energy
to accelerate critical research,
development and demonstration
programs to increase the availability of
renewable energy and storage
technologies to increase power
generation from solar, wind, geothermal
and hydropower resources; and
· Allocating $15 million in grants
for advanced and innovative technology
regarding optimal use of water,
wastewater, water reuse systems and
energy, while directing the secretary of
energy to establish an energy-water
advisory committee.
American Petroleum Institute Vice
President of Policy, Economics and
Regulatory Affairs Frank Macchiarola
says HR 4447 leaves much to be desired.
"This is a missed opportunity to
advance bipartisan solutions to
address the real risks of climate
change and ensure long-term
availability of affordable, reliable and
cleaner American energy," he
assesses. "There was a chance to pass
a bill that took an important step
forward in promoting carbon capture

technology, and yet here we are taking
two steps backward with provisions
that hurt consumers in the middle of a
global pandemic.
"A serious effort to tackle energy and
climate challenges would focus on
making measurable progress rather than
ramming through a 900-page bill that
dramatically redefines the nation's
regulatory system without any hearings
or time for debate through regular
order," Macchiarola insists.
The cybersecurity legislation came in
the form of four bills, all of which passed
the House in the final days of September:
· HR 359, the Enhancing Grid
Security Through Public-Private
Partnerships Act, sponsored by
Representatives Robert Latta, R-Oh.,
and Jerry McNerney, D-Ca.;
· HR 360, the Cyber Sense Act,
also by Latta and McNerney;
· HR 362, the Energy Emergency
Leadership Act, sponsored by
Representatives Bobby Rush, D-Il., and
Tim Walberg, R-Mi.; and
· HR 5760, the Grid Security
Research and Development Act by
Representatives Ami Bera, D-Ca., and
Randy Weber, R-Tx.
According to press accounts, all four
bills were passed by unanimous voice
vote. Among those lauding their success
are Energy and Commerce Committee
ranking member Greg Walden, R-Or.,
and Energy Subcommittee ranking
member Fred Upton, R-Mi.
"The COVID-19 pandemic has
underscored the importance of
stopping supply chain threats,
including ensuring the security of our
electric grid. From electricity to WiFi,
a secure, reliable grid is vital to all
Americans," says a joint statement
from Walden and Upton. "We thank
our House colleagues for supporting
three bipartisan bills that will bolster
our energy security and keep our grid
safe from cyberattacks, and we urge
our Senate colleagues to take swift
action to keep our electric grid safe
and running." r
EPA Finalizes Procedure
On Guidance Documents
WASHINGTON-The U.S.
Environmental Protection Agency on
Sept. 14 finalized a new set of
guidelines and procedures it proposed in
May pertaining to agency guidance
documents (AOGR, June 2020, pg. 14).
As described by the Texas Independent
Producers & Royalty Owners
Association, the new regulation "will
provide the public new levels of
transparency and ensure that EPA is not
creating new regulatory obligations
through its guidance documents."
In a speech he gave on the day the
regulation was finalized, EPA
Administrator Andrew Wheeler said
consistent requirements and
procedures for issuing guidance
documents was critical. "Today's
action is perhaps the biggest change in
administrative procedures in a
generation," he affirmed. "This
historic rule guarantees the
transparency the public deserves when
engaging with the agency. This is a
massive step forward for EPA,
bringing these legal documents into
the light."
According to the agency, the final
rule, among other elements, will:
· Establish the first formal petition
process for the public to request that
EPA modify, withdraw or reinstate a
guidance document;
· Ensure that the agency's guidance
documents are developed with
appropriate review and are accessible to
the public; and
· Allow public participation in
developing significant guidance
documents.
Senator James Inhofe, R-Ok., is
among the policymakers lauding the
agency's move, and says it puts into
the Federal Register changes that he
has previously sought through
legislation. "After previous
administrations abused the guidance
process to initiate regulatory changes
that they could not achieve through
the permissible regulatory process, I
fought for reform of our federal
regulations and guidance transparency
for years," Inhofe says. "Fortunately,
Andrew Wheeler and President Trump
agree with me and continue to strive
for transparency while cutting
unnecessary red tape."
Before the rule was finalized, EPA
notes, the agency debuted an online
guidance portal for public access to its
guidance documents. In doing so, EPA
says it has, for the first time, placed
more than 9,000 guidance documents
onto a searchable database at
www.epa.gov/guidance. r
